#eec6e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eec6e0 is composed of 93.3% red, 77.6%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 321 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 85.5%. #eec6e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dd8dc1.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#eec6e0 color description : Light grayish pink.
#eec6e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eec6e0 has RGB values of R:238, G:198,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.06,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15648480.
